Overview The CMC brand is synonymous with technical rescue and rope access expertise around the world. Our innovative tools, education and training are used by professionals in the fire service, USAR, wilderness rescue, rigging, tactical and work-at-height industries. As co-founders of the Society of Professional Rope Access Technicians (SPRAT), and the International Technical Rescue Symposium (ITRS), we remain committed to innovating across all work-at-height industries. An employee-owned company, CMC is an ISO-9001 certified manufacturing facility. For more information, visit www.cmcpro.com. Mission CMC's purpose is to help save lives.
